初始化出来的tree没有父级勾选
ztree吧
全部回复
仅看楼主
level 1
我从后台出来的数据初始化了一些内容的勾选,但显示的是灰色框。不是勾选框。如果让初始化出来的数据自动级联呢?
2013年01月14日 07点01分 1
level 1
我的意思是,下一级全部勾选了,那么当前这一级也就默认勾选上
2013年01月14日 07点01分 2
level 11
zTree 是不会对初始化数据进行干扰的, 请你根据自己的逻辑让父节点进行勾选
方法一:初始化 zTree 之前先预处理父节点
方法二:初始化 zTree 之后,利用 checkNode 方法进行勾选
2013年01月14日 12点01分 3
嗯,十分感谢您的回复。我想问下,为什么没有提供这个功能呢?会降低性能吗?之前用过easyui tree,做到了这一点,但整体效率上和ztree差远了。
2013年01月15日 00点01分
回复 蜚语霏雨飞鱼 : 一定要实现应该也是可以得,只是不想强行干扰初始化的数据,为了避免数据混乱,减少复杂逻辑; 为了适应更多的需求!
2013年01月15日 01点01分
回复 zTreeAPI :哦,方法2在IE6下还是速度慢,会报出JS运行时间超长那个错误。方法1,我觉得服务器端太费时间,判断某一个父节点是否勾选,需要判断他下面的所有子节点。所有现在我保持原样了。
2013年01月15日 01点01分
回复 蜚语霏雨飞鱼 : 方法一可以用js 实现呀; 方法二你不好好弄一下算法,肯定会产生性能问题,因为还会有父子关联的操作;
2013年01月15日 08点01分
1